Hopeless customer service and no notifications of flight cancellations or delays, unless you go and ask them. They gave me a ticket from Montreal to Newark via Toronto (Billy Bishop). They instead send me to Hamilton (an airport 1 hour away from Toronto) and arranged a bus from there to drop me at Toronto at 1:30am in the night, only to realize that the Toronto airport is closed till 5am. Looks like this airport is closed everyday from 11 PM to 5 AM. I did not have anywhere to go and spent the night in the cold in cafes. Nowhere I have seen this kind of treatment by an airline. They don't have the minimum decency to warn me that the airport is closed.

Our first flight experience with Porter Airlines from Toronto to Chicago was a disaster. We were scheduled to fly from Toronto to Chicago to be at wedding celebrations later that evening. 20 minutes past the scheduled departure, our flight was cancelled due to mechanical issues (there were 3 flights cancelled that day due to mechanical problems), and the only option provided to us by rude ground crew was to take the first flight out the next day. They refused to put us on a wait list for the remaining flights for the rest of the day. Porter are not equipped to handle the slightest deviation from normal operation of their daily schedule. Ground crew give you the impression that Porter is doing its customers a favour by operating an airline, rather than the other way around. We finally managed to get waitlisted for remaining flights that day, and did get on the very last flight that night, having spent 10 hours at the airport. If you have to be somewhere at a particular time, don’t fly with Porter - you don’t know how bad they are until you have a problem!
